PM Shehbaz Sharif leaves for London to attend Queen Elizabeth’s state funeral
State funeral of Queen Elizabeth II is to be held on September 19, 2022


Rawalpindi: Prime Minister Muhammad Shehbaz Sharif on Saturday left for the United Kingdom to attend the state funeral of Queen Elizabeth II.
Defence Minister Khawaja Asif and Federal Minister for Information Marriyum Aurangzeb also accompanied the prime minister on the visit.
During his stay in London, the premier will meet his brother, former prime minister and PML-N supremo Nawaz Sharif besides attending the last rites of Queen Elizabeth-II scheduled to be held on September 19, 2022.
He will leave for New York on the same day to participate in the 77th session of the United Nations General Assembly beginning from the 20th of this month. There he will address the UNGA’s session.
PM Shehbaz will also meet with world leaders on the sidelines of the session.
